Aug 22-29 trial for man charged with cheating three persons

-

KOTA KINABALU: The Magistrate’s Court here yesterday set August 22-29 for the trial of a man charged with five counts of cheating.

Magistrate Cindy Mc Juce Balitus fixed the date after the accused, Chong Seng Fui, 35, pleaded not guilty to all the charges under Section 420 of the Penal Code yesterday.

Each of the charge carries a maximum jail sentence of 10 years and whipping and also liable to a fine, upon conviction.

On the first charge, the accused was alleged to have deceived a man by saying that he could set up an air-conditioni­ng unit and a bed at the victim’s house, and induced the victim to give him RM22,000 at Jalan Istiadat at 5.20 pm on March 14.

On the second charge, the accused was alleged to have cheated a woman of RM10,120 in Likas at 12.30 pm on December 6, 2016 by saying that he could help to speed up a house purchase at Taman Sinar Jaya in Tuaran.

On the third to fifth charges, the accused was alleged to have cheated a man over house valuation, stamp duty and lawyer’s payments, and induced the victim to give him RM500, RM4,000 and RM700, respective­ly, at a bank in Putatan between September 1 and 5, 2016.

In an unrelated case, accused Yap Yeh Chen was fined RM3,000, in default, three months’ jail by the same court after he admitted to possessing gambling implements, namely, a pen, 13 pieces of papers with written four digits numbers and cash

The accused was caught committing the offence at an unnumbered premises at Taman Jumbo in Putatan on October 20, 2016.

Inspector Mohd Rasydan Jasni appeared for the prosecutio­n.
